Understanding Schema: A Comprehensive Guide
That idea of schema plays as the essential component in various areas, especially in website creation, data organization, and SEO. Schema refers to an systematic structure that aids in organizing information in the way that renders it more straightforward to comprehend and handle.
As we talk about schema in this sphere of the internet, we are usually discussing Schema.org, the collaborative initiative established by leading internet companies like Google, Bing, Yahoo, and Yandex. This collaboration aims to create a universal language for information classification on the internet.
The key objective of schema implementation is to enable digital platforms more efficiently comprehend what's presented on online platforms. By using schema markup, website owners can supply supplementary information about their information, that search engines can use to show richer listings.
As an illustration, if you have the webpage that sells items, implementing schema code can help Google understand particular details about your merchandise, such as value, availability, ratings, and more. This data can then show up in rich snippets on Google listings, potentially boosting your user interaction.
Multiple types of schema exist, every one created for certain categories of data. Several widely used varieties comprise:
Organization schema: Provides data about the organization
Person schema: Outlines particulars about persons
Product schema: Showcases specifics of items
Event schema: Presents information about upcoming occasions
Recipe schema: Exhibits culinary directions and elements
Review schema: Highlights customer evaluations
Incorporating schema structure to your website necessitates a certain technical knowledge, but the positive outcomes are often significant. The main popular technique for adding schema is through structured data in microdata.
JSON-LD (JavaScript Object Notation for Linked Data) has become the recommended format for adding schema structure, as it allows site owners to insert the markup code in the script instead of integrating it straight into the HTML.
The following is an basic demonstration of the method JSON-LD schema markup might look for a local business:
json
Download
Copy code
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
copyright type="application/ld+json">
"@context": "https://schema.org",
"@type": "LocalBusiness",
"name": "Example Business Name",
"address":
"@type": "PostalAddress",
"streetAddress": "123 Example Street",
"addressLocality": "Example City",
"addressRegion": "EX",
"postalCode": "12345",
"addressCountry": "US"
,
"telephone": "(555) 555-5555",
"openingHours": "Mo,Tu,We,Th,Fr 09:00-17:00"
The benefits of adding schema code reach past just enhancing more info how your web pages looks in search results. It can also aid with voice search optimization, as devices like Google Assistant, Alexa, and Siri commonly utilize schema information to provide information to questions.
Furthermore, schema implementation serves a vital role in advanced internet functionality, that aims to develop a smarter internet where machines can comprehend the meaning behind data, rather than just handling keywords.
To verify if your schema code is correct, it's possible to employ the Structured Data Testing Tool or Google's Rich Results Test. These utilities may help you find any issues in your code and verify that search engines can properly interpret your schema information.
While web platforms persist to advance, the value of schema implementation is anticipated to expand. Online platforms that successfully apply rich data can obtain superior positioning in online visibility, likely resulting in improved user engagement, enhanced user experience, and ultimately, enhanced sales.
In conclusion, schema forms an effective tool in the developer's toolkit. By providing digital platforms with explicit information about your website, you enable them to more effectively serve your material to potential visitors, in the end creating an improved web experience for all users participating.